OPERATION

1. The clutch will transfer maximum power after about two
hours of normal operation. During this break-in period clutch
slippage may occur. The clutch should be kept free of oil or
other moisture for efficient operation.
2. Drill holes without placing excessive body weight on the unit.
The auger operates most efficiently with a shaving action
caused by the weight of the unit itself.

3. Never run engine indoors. Exhaust fumes are deadly.
4. Do not use an ice auger in the earth.
5. The ice auger blade protector should be attached to the auger
blade when not in use. This will protect the cutting edge of
the ice auger blades.
6. To attach the auger to the powerhead, in the event this has not
been done, align hole at top of shaft with output shaft hole.
Insert bolt and secure bolt with provided allen wrench.
NOTE: The ends of the bolt should be flush with auger collar.
Bolt head and thread end should never go beyond ice collar.
USING THE SCREW-TYPE,
mANUAl vENTING GAS CAP
Your power ice auger is equipped with a screw type, manual
venting gas cap.
1. Before starting the engine, turn the screw in the top of the
gas cap all the way open (counterclockwise) to its venting
position. To ensure that gas will not spill during use, check
that the gas cap is screwed on tightly and the gas cap screw
is in the venting position.
2. After using the power ice auger and before putting away
or transporting it in a vehicle, screw the gas cap screw on
(clockwise) tightly. DO NOT OvER-TIGHTEN, AS THIS mAY
DAmAGE THE O-RING. This will prevent gas from leaking
during storage.
NOTE: When storing unit for prolonged periods of time in
warm weather, always vent gas cap to prevent gas from
leaking from carburetor.
